Solution for 2x^2-20x-5=0 equation:


Simplifying
2x2 + -20x + -5 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-5 + -20x + 2x2 = 0

Solving
-5 + -20x + 2x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Begin completing the square.  Divide all terms by
2 the coefficient of the squared term: 

Divide each side by '2'.
-2.5 + -10x + x2 = 0

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'2.5' to each side of the equation.
-2.5 + -10x + 2.5 + x2 = 0 + 2.5

Reorder the terms:
-2.5 + 2.5 + -10x + x2 = 0 + 2.5

Combine like terms: -2.5 + 2.5 = 0.0
0.0 + -10x + x2 = 0 + 2.5
-10x + x2 = 0 + 2.5

Combine like terms: 0 + 2.5 = 2.5
-10x + x2 = 2.5

The x term is -10x.  Take half its coefficient (-5).
Square it (25) and add it to both sides.

Add '25' to each side of the equation.
-10x + 25 + x2 = 2.5 + 25

Reorder the terms:
25 + -10x + x2 = 2.5 + 25

Combine like terms: 2.5 + 25 = 27.5
25 + -10x + x2 = 27.5

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(x + -5)(x + -5) = 27.5

Calculate the square root of the right side: 5.244044241

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(x + -5) equal to 5.244044241 and -5.244044241.

Subproblem 1

x + -5 = 5.244044241 Simplifying x + -5 = 5.244044241 Reorder the terms: -5 + x = 5.244044241 Solving -5 + x = 5.244044241 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+ x = 5.244044241 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+ x = 5.244044241 + 5 x = 5.244044241 + 5 Combine like terms: 5.244044241 + 5 = 10.244044241 x = 10.244044241 Simplifying x = 10.244044241

Subproblem 2

x + -5 = -5.244044241 Simplifying x + -5 = -5.244044241 Reorder the terms: -5 + x = -5.244044241 Solving -5 + x = -5.244044241 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+ x = -5.244044241 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+ x = -5.244044241 + 5 x = -5.244044241 + 5 Combine like terms: -5.244044241 + 5 = -0.244044241 x = -0.244044241 Simplifying x = -0.244044241

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. x = {10.244044241, -0.244044241}
